In the summer of 1978 he announced his retirement from professional football. Known by the fans as "the most beautiful gipsy in Giuleşti (the neighborhood where Rapid plays), Neagu played his entire career for Rapid Bucureşti.He played 286 games scoring 110 goals. Neague debuted for the Romania national football team in February 1970 in a 1-1 draw against Peru.
In his second international cap, a 1-1 draw against West Germany, he scored his first international goal.
He earned 17 caps for the Romania national football team and participated in the 1970. Neagu died on 17 April 2010, at age 61 in a Bucharest hospital.
